Yii实现简单分页的方法


Posted in PHP onApril 29, 2016

本文实例讲述了Yii实现简单分页的方法。分享给大家供大家参考,具体如下:

yii分页方法

function actionPage(){
    $criteria=new CDbCriteria();
    $count=Archives::model()->count($criteria);
    $pages=new CPagination($count);
    // results per page
    $pages->pageSize=10;
    $pages->applyLimit($criteria);
    $models=Archives::model()->findAll($criteria);
    $this->render('Archives', array(
      'models' => $models,
      'pages' => $pages
    ));
}

view视图的方法

<ul>
<?php foreach($models as $model): ?>
 <li><?php echo $model->title;?></li>
<?php endforeach; ?>
</ul>
<?php $this->widget('CLinkPager', array(
  'pages' => $pages,
    'header'=>'',
    'prevPageLabel'=>'上一页',
    'nextPageLabel'=>'下一页',
    'cssFile'=>'css/cc/css.css',
)) ?>

希望本文所述对大家基于Yii框架的PHP程序设计有所帮助。

PHP 相关文章推荐
类的另类用法--数据的封装
Oct 09 PHP
PHP投票系统防刷票判断流程分析
Feb 04 PHP
PHP eval函数使用介绍
Dec 08 PHP
改写ThinkPHP的U方法使其路由下分页正常
Jul 02 PHP
ThinkPHP让分页保持搜索状态的方法
Jul 02 PHP
PHP中常见的缓存技术实例分析
Sep 23 PHP
php 截取GBK文档某个位置开始的n个字符方法
Mar 08 PHP
thinkphp5实现无限级分类
Feb 18 PHP
thinkphp5使用无限极分类
Feb 18 PHP
PHP hex2bin()函数用法讲解
Feb 25 PHP
PHP迭代器和生成器用法实例分析
Sep 28 PHP
YII2框架中添加自定义模块的方法实例分析
Mar 18 PHP
php实现在站点里面添加邮件发送的功能
Apr 28 #PHP
php提交过来的数据生成为txt文件
Apr 28 #PHP
php生成txt文件实例代码介绍
Apr 28 #PHP
100行PHP代码实现socks5代理服务器
Apr 28 #PHP
Yii2实现ajax上传图片插件用法
Apr 28 #PHP
thinkphp3.2实现上传图片的控制器方法
Apr 28 #PHP
PHP简单实现文本计数器的方法
Apr 28 #PHP
You might like
PHP 数组排序方法总结 推荐收藏
2010/06/30 PHP
php 获取SWF动画截图示例代码
2014/02/10 PHP
PHP编程实现微信企业向用户付款的方法示例
2017/07/26 PHP
Laravel 自定命令以及生成文件的例子
2019/10/23 PHP
JS 自定义函数缺省值的设置方法
2010/05/05 Javascript
Jquery之Bind方法参数传递与接收的三种方法
2014/06/24 Javascript
js构造函数、索引数组和属性的实现方式和使用
2014/11/16 Javascript
详解AngularJS中的表格使用
2015/06/16 Javascript
Node.js中使用jQuery的做法
2016/08/17 Javascript
jQuery简单创建节点的方法
2016/09/09 Javascript
jQuery内容过滤选择器用法示例
2016/09/09 Javascript
微信小程序 框架详解及实例应用
2016/09/26 Javascript
js带闹铃功能的倒计时代码
2016/09/29 Javascript
微信小程序 SocketIO 实例讲解
2016/10/13 Javascript
利用js编写网页进度条效果
2017/10/08 Javascript
js布局实现单选按钮控件
2020/01/17 Javascript
在Vue中实现随hash改变响应菜单高亮
2020/03/09 Javascript
Python循环语句之break与continue的用法
2015/10/14 Python
Python文件处理
2016/02/29 Python
Python机器学习之决策树算法
2017/12/22 Python
django manage.py扩展自定义命令方法
2018/05/27 Python
Python并行分布式框架Celery详解
2018/10/15 Python
flask框架自定义url转换器操作详解
2020/01/25 Python
python实现同一局域网下传输图片
2020/03/20 Python
pygame用blit()实现动画效果的示例代码
2020/05/28 Python
python中time包实例详解
2021/02/02 Python
详解canvas drawImage()方法绘制图片不显示的问题
2018/10/08 HTML / CSS
英国最大的宝石首饰超市:QP Jewellers
2018/09/23 全球购物
捷克移动配件网上商店:ProMobily.cz
2019/03/15 全球购物
Spongelle官网:美国的创意护肤洗护品牌
2019/05/15 全球购物
定义一结构体数组表示分数,并求两个分数相加之和
2013/06/11 面试题
优秀党员事迹材料
2014/12/18 职场文书
毕业论文答辩开场白和答辩技巧
2015/05/27 职场文书
国庆节新闻稿
2015/07/17 职场文书
学习商务礼仪心得体会
2016/01/22 职场文书
Nginx动静分离配置实现与说明
2022/04/07 Servers